Quiet Operation Supports a More Comfortable Beauty Environment

Noise is an important consideration for electrical beauty equipment. A loud motor can make an otherwise simple manicure session feel less comfortable, particularly when the device is used in a bedroom, apartment, shared workspace, or other quiet environment.

Low-noise operation can help create a more relaxed experience. It also makes the equipment easier to integrate into everyday routines without creating unnecessary disturbance. For professional nail technicians, quieter equipment can contribute to a more pleasant salon atmosphere, especially when several services are performed throughout the day.

Motor Performance and Noise Control

Reducing operating noise requires more than simply selecting a quiet motor. Product engineers may need to consider motor balance, internal mounting, housing materials, airflow, vibration transmission, and the interaction between rotating components.

Effective engineering seeks to maintain stable operation while controlling unnecessary mechanical vibration. When these elements are properly coordinated, the equipment can deliver a smoother operating experience while preserving the functionality required for routine nail care.

Safety and Maintenance Remain Essential

Convenience should never replace responsible product use. Nail equipment is designed to interact directly with the nail surface, so users should follow appropriate operating practices and select accessories that match the intended application.

Manufacturers also have an important role in product safety. Appropriate material selection, component testing, electrical protection, mechanical inspection, and quality control contribute to reliable product performance.

Maintaining Clean Working Conditions

Regular cleaning is particularly important for manicure equipment. Dust and cosmetic residue should not be allowed to accumulate around functional components. Cleaning procedures should follow the manufacturer's recommendations and should not introduce excessive moisture into electrical areas.

For professional environments, maintenance routines should also fit existing hygiene procedures. Easy-to-clean surfaces and practical component structures can help technicians keep equipment ready for repeated use.

International Standards Influence Nail Equipment Development

As nail care products enter international markets, manufacturers need to understand different regulatory expectations. Electrical beauty equipment may be subject to market-specific requirements related to electrical safety, electromagnetic compatibility, energy efficiency, and material restrictions.

Compliance therefore becomes an important part of international product development. Manufacturers with experience serving multiple regions are better positioned to integrate regulatory considerations into product design rather than treating certification as a final-stage procedure.
